Commit Graph

156 Commits

Author SHA1 Message Date
Fletcher T. Penney
667cf9c494 NOTE: Update documentation; CHANGED: Ignore the documentation directory 2016-08-24 22:01:59 -04:00
Fletcher T. Penney
9903b9ebb6 ADDED: Support for doxygen documentation in gh-pages branch 2016-08-24 21:44:09 -04:00
Fletcher T. Penney
eb0419d181 Merge branch 'master' of github.com:fletcher/c-template 2016-08-24 20:06:59 -04:00
Fletcher T. Penney
2038f6b331 ADDED: Boilerplate to use cmake subdirectories 2016-08-24 20:06:23 -04:00
Fletcher T. Penney
fa00bc29e9 NOTE: Update copyright info/dates 2016-05-06 11:45:16 -04:00
Fletcher T. Penney
1935f9bd3c ADDED: Append array of c characters in signle step 2016-05-06 11:41:23 -04:00
Fletcher T. Penney
5c1561cd58 CHANGED: Use faster method of getting input from stdin or a file -- old method was *slow* 2016-05-06 11:38:34 -04:00
Fletcher T. Penney
de34961844 ADDED: Include support for Xcode libraries to be iOS compatible 2015-12-04 10:50:07 -05:00
Fletcher T. Penney
c376c8f1c4 FIXED: Remove unneeded install directive; FIXED: Fix public header install prefix (I think) 2015-12-04 09:05:53 -05:00
Fletcher T. Penney
692b1599b5 ADDED: Beginning code for public header file support; ADDED: Beginning configuration for OS X Bundle/Framework targets 2015-12-04 08:56:21 -05:00
Fletcher T. Penney
d39d945239 Autogenerate changelog since last commit to master 2015-11-15 21:54:40 -05:00
Fletcher T. Penney
9df8dde5aa Merge branch 'master' of github.com:fletcher/c-template 2015-11-15 20:55:57 -05:00
Fletcher T. Penney
41952b683a add 32 bit flag to older MinGW toolchain 2015-11-15 20:55:25 -05:00
Fletcher T. Penney
87eb004874 update cmake notes 2015-11-13 09:53:39 -05:00
Fletcher T. Penney
af449f48bd add comment about static libraries 2015-11-12 19:19:04 -05:00
Fletcher T. Penney
f302a6184e use static linking for Linux to try to make binaries more compatible 2015-11-12 19:18:21 -05:00
Fletcher T. Penney
e558d45a92 add notes about xcodebuild 2015-11-12 16:14:22 -05:00
Fletcher T. Penney
2f5854d598 improve doxygen features 2015-11-12 11:23:28 -05:00
Fletcher T. Penney
285dd030a0 update source templates to improve doxygen support 2015-11-12 10:39:56 -05:00
Fletcher T. Penney
1bfbae0894 Update README handling to autogenerate and copy to top-level; configure cmake to reference this top-level README for installer/doxygen/etc. 2015-11-12 09:33:09 -05:00
Fletcher T. Penney
b10603b1fa add notes to git scripts 2015-11-12 09:31:28 -05:00
Fletcher T. Penney
385d381f21 additional description of clang's scan-build support 2015-11-11 16:29:00 -05:00
Fletcher T. Penney
0323644051 improve Makefile; add scan-build support 2015-11-11 11:18:21 -05:00
Fletcher T. Penney
a2ff014c6c add hints for Xcode settings 2015-11-09 09:36:44 -05:00
Fletcher T. Penney
aec80c96c4 tell us where to look for version.h 2015-11-09 07:58:43 -05:00
Fletcher T. Penney
f63d297e53 restructure CMakeLists; support Zip package generator flag 2015-11-09 07:42:50 -05:00
Fletcher T. Penney
77797438bf Add standardized c project version header 2015-11-09 07:29:32 -05:00
Fletcher T. Penney
88c3f9a354 Try to get MinGW-w64 properly configured 2015-11-09 07:23:13 -05:00
Fletcher T. Penney
db93d84d96 update master Makefile; add MinGW 64 bit support 2015-11-09 07:07:57 -05:00
Fletcher T. Penney
af29f50383 reorganize OS specific configuration 2015-11-03 12:17:19 -05:00
Fletcher T. Penney
487b2a1d53 fix bug 2015-11-02 18:34:10 -05:00
Fletcher T. Penney
443277708b fix CuTest exit code; add valgrind support 2015-11-02 18:29:45 -05:00
Fletcher T. Penney
6c6e7a6cec add gitignore file 2015-11-02 16:50:34 -05:00
Fletcher T. Penney
c8256ffc2b don't worry about OS X config by default 2015-07-07 16:14:34 -04:00
Fletcher T. Penney
fca8712084 add PHONY entries to Makefile 2015-06-28 17:50:35 -04:00
Fletcher T. Penney
94f8b8f446 fix bug 2015-06-27 20:04:23 -04:00
Fletcher T. Penney
b2340ca847 Merge branch 'master' of github.com:fletcher/c-template 2015-06-27 19:58:36 -04:00
Fletcher T. Penney
de2a36c062 add doxygen features to template 2015-06-27 19:57:23 -04:00
Fletcher T. Penney
25b2e6c710 update link_git_modules and describe in README 2015-06-16 10:28:29 -04:00
Fletcher T. Penney
949dc55503 add tools to help manage submodules 2015-06-15 20:45:51 -04:00
Fletcher T. Penney
0c4ec3d317 basic cpack configuration 2015-06-14 22:04:15 -04:00
Fletcher T. Penney
9cd9ec1599 improve README and doxygen set-up 2015-06-14 16:24:32 -04:00
Fletcher T. Penney
f13eddca6d fix project name 2015-06-14 10:37:14 -04:00
Fletcher T. Penney
a532625079 fix license info 2015-06-14 10:32:16 -04:00
Fletcher T. Penney
fb3d194f91 Document something about doxygen 2015-06-14 10:21:11 -04:00
Fletcher T. Penney
d9e97f5ad9 fix bug 2015-06-14 10:11:45 -04:00
Fletcher T. Penney
863b28e8ac split primary source files from utility source files (distinction is more for doxygen) 2015-06-14 10:04:50 -04:00
Fletcher T. Penney
301c69b50d fix bug in README for doxygen 2015-06-14 09:53:22 -04:00
Fletcher T. Penney
f4f4dd2d8f fix doxygen template 2015-06-14 09:49:58 -04:00
Fletcher T. Penney
ab6c826791 Use README.md as main page for doxygen documentation; use table instead of metadata for project info in README 2015-06-14 09:48:20 -04:00